Aside from Poker and perhaps also Roulette, Craps is one of the most well acknowledged games, both in the real life and virtual gaming environment. Craps’ conspicuousness and fascination draw both nonprofessional and experienced gamers and the money assets change, attracting both general gamblers and big spenders. The unique part of craps is that is not constrained to the casino, but craps can also be gambled on at house parties and also in alleys. This is what causes the game of craps so dominant due to the fact that everybody can learn how to enjoy it.
Craps is easy to pickup as the principles are not very advanced. Oftentimes, the only prerequisites for a excellent game of craps are a pair of dice and a few folks.
